It's not really as simple as using an oral glucose to bring your sugars back up, as your body will still produce insulin to cover whatever glucose you are consuming as it doesn't realize that you are adding an outside insulin source. I had a friend who is a very high level competitor who knows exactly what he is doing when it comes to steroid and hormone injections. He had a bit higher intensity training session than normal and went hypo because of it. It took me stuffing 8 cans of Coke down his throat before he was able to think on his own. I never want to see that happen again to anyone I know.
